The beginning of this video is time spent with my dad emptying his pollen traps and talking a little about beekeeping equipment.
From that we transition into a little bit of commercial or side line beekeeping where we are stacking honey supers on eighty double deep palleted hive sets.
For desert we have a nice honey loaded hive removal in the swamps of La France Mississippi. It was a very long day which could have made several videos.
Since I can only put out one video per week I just threw it all in so it wouldn't get lost in storage.

Out of curiosity what would happen if you framed up brood like that covered/saturated with honey? Could they clean it? Also brings up a question I always forget to ask, all eggs in cells have royal jelly, right? then if it's going to be made queen it's loaded with more royal jelly? what about worker brood and drones, what and how are they fed? could larva eat honey? I know by watching Hornet King that hornets and wasps bring meat to the larva which is then eaten and then regurgitated to feed the adults. I know bees aren't quite like that but also made me wonder what and how bee larva are fed..... A bit long winded I know, feel free to just tell me to google it lol. THANKS!!!
@628DirtRooster
@628DirtRooster 4 жыл бұрын
They will clean it if you make them which can require a little effort. The capped brood isn't really hurt. It's the open brood that would be affected/drown. The wouldn't be able to clean it fast enough though and small hive beetles would start getting a foot hold and a rotten smell would get in there from the dead larvae they didn't get to.
